It was a privilege to share my passion with psychology graduates from around the world last Monday 24th of September 2018 in Ubud, Bali. The 2 hours workshop was focused on Cognitive Behavioural Therapy & Mindfulness in multicultural settings from a personal clinical perspective introducing the intensive Choices Personalized Retreats program in Bali. Having worked in the UK, the Middle East and now in Bali Indonesia, I have had the opportunity to meet people from all over the world. Each person with a different background and culture. As a psychologist, I have always been sensitive to adjusting my approach to meet the needs of each person. This has not only helped create stronger bonds in the therapeutic relationship but also have better outcomes in the healing and / or recovery process of each person.
